Master’s Degree Courses in Ireland

Ireland offers specialised master’s programmes that help students develop advanced knowledge, practical skills and industry experience in their chosen field. Indian students can select from taught, research-based and conversion programmes according to their previous qualifications and career plans.

Most taught master’s degrees in Ireland are completed in one year. They generally fall under Level 9 of Ireland’s National Framework of Qualifications and carry between 60 and 120 ECTS credits. Research programmes and certain specialised courses may take longer.

    Popular Master’s Courses in Ireland

    Course area Popular courses and specialisations Commonly suitable academic background Typical duration
    Computer Science Computer Science, Software Development and Advanced Computing Computer Science, IT or Engineering 1–2 years
    Data Science and Analytics Data Science, Business Analytics and Big Data Analytics Computing, Mathematics, Statistics, Engineering or Business 1 year
    Artificial Intelligence Artificial Intelligence, Machine Learning and Intelligent Systems Computing, Engineering, Mathematics or related subjects 1 year
    Cybersecurity Cybersecurity, Network Security and Digital Forensics Computer Science, IT or Electronics 1 year
    Business and Management International Management, Strategic Management and Entrepreneurship Business or graduates from other disciplines, depending on the course 1 year
    Finance and FinTech Finance, Financial Analytics, Accounting and Financial Technology Finance, Commerce, Economics, Mathematics or Engineering 1 year
    Engineering Mechanical, Civil, Electronic, Biomedical and Energy Engineering Relevant engineering discipline 1–2 years
    Pharmaceutical and Life Sciences Pharmaceutical Science, Biotechnology, Biopharmaceuticals and Clinical Research Pharmacy, Life Sciences, Biotechnology or Chemistry 1 year
    Supply Chain Management Supply Chain Management, Logistics and Operations Management Business, Engineering, Commerce or related subjects 1 year
    Healthcare and Public Health Public Health, Health Data Science and Healthcare Management Medicine, Nursing, Pharmacy, Life Sciences or Healthcare 1–2 years
    Digital Marketing Digital Marketing, Marketing Analytics and International Marketing Business, Marketing, Media or other eligible disciplines 1 year
    Hospitality and Tourism International Tourism, Hospitality Management and Event Management Hospitality, Tourism, Business or related subjects 1 year

    Scholarships for Master’s Students

    Indian students applying for master’s programmes in Ireland may be eligible for government-funded, university-specific and department-level scholarships. Most awards are competitive and consider academic performance, professional achievements, extracurricular activities and the overall quality of the application.

    The Government of Ireland International Education Scholarship supports selected non-EU students studying at NFQ Level 9 or 10. It includes a €10,000 stipend and a full tuition-fee waiver from the participating institution for one year of full-time study.

    Other notable university scholarships include:

    • Trinity Global Excellence Postgraduate Scholarship, offering a tuition-fee reduction of between €2,000 and €5,000.
    • UCD Global Excellence Scholarship, offering limited awards covering 50% or 100% of tuition fees for eligible graduate taught programmes.
    • International merit scholarships offered by University College Cork, University of Galway, Dublin City University, Maynooth University and other participating institutions.

    Top Irish Universities for Master’s Programmes

    University Popular master’s study areas
    Trinity College Dublin Computer Science, Data Science, Engineering, Business, Finance and Public Health
    University College Dublin Business, Finance, Artificial Intelligence, Data Analytics, Engineering and Agriculture
    University College Cork Computing, Business Analytics, Pharmaceutical Science, Food Science and Public Health
    University of Galway Data Analytics, Engineering, Business, Biomedical Science and Medical Technology
    University of Limerick Supply Chain Management, Engineering, Business Analytics, Artificial Intelligence and Public Health
    Dublin City University Computing, Artificial Intelligence, Finance, Management, Engineering and Communications
    Maynooth University Data Science, Computer Science, Business, Psychology, Law and Humanities
    Technological University Dublin Computing, Engineering, Management, Hospitality, Food Science and Construction
    RCSI University of Medicine and Health Sciences Healthcare Management, Surgery, Pharmacy, Physiotherapy, Nursing and Clinical Research
    Atlantic Technological University Computing, Data Analytics, Engineering, Supply Chain Management and Business
